org.python.core
Class AutoInternalTables

java.lang.Object
  extended byorg.python.core.InternalTables
      extended byorg.python.core.InternalTables1
          extended byorg.python.core.InternalTables2
              extended byorg.python.core.AutoInternalTables
Direct Known Subclasses:
SoftIInternalTables, WeakInternalTables

public abstract class AutoInternalTables
extends InternalTables2


Nested Class Summary
 
Nested classes inherited from class org.python.core.InternalTables
InternalTables._LazyRep
 
Constructor Summary
AutoInternalTables()
           
 
Method Summary
 void _beginCanonical()
           
 void _beginLazyCanonical()
           
 void _beginOverAdapterClasses()
           
 void _beginOverAdapters()
           
 boolean _doesSomeAutoUnload()
           
 void _flush(PyJavaClass jc)
           
 void _forceCleanup()
           
 Object _next()
           
 
Methods inherited from class org.python.core.InternalTables2
_flushCurrent
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AutoInternalTables

public AutoInternalTables()
Method Detail

_doesSomeAutoUnload

public boolean _doesSomeAutoUnload()
Overrides:
_doesSomeAutoUnload in class InternalTables

_forceCleanup

public void _forceCleanup()
Overrides:
_forceCleanup in class InternalTables

_beginCanonical

public void _beginCanonical()
Overrides:
_beginCanonical in class InternalTables2

_beginLazyCanonical

public void _beginLazyCanonical()
Overrides:
_beginLazyCanonical in class InternalTables2

_beginOverAdapterClasses

public void _beginOverAdapterClasses()
Overrides:
_beginOverAdapterClasses in class InternalTables2

_beginOverAdapters

public void _beginOverAdapters()
Overrides:
_beginOverAdapters in class InternalTables2

_next

public Object _next()
Overrides:
_next in class InternalTables2

_flush

public void _flush(PyJavaClass jc)
Overrides:
_flush in class InternalTables1